## Intern Cohort Arrival — Building Access

The Brindlewood summer interns arrive Monday, 09:00, at the Larkspur Atrium entrance. Assistants: collect printed schedules from the Hive Room beforehand. Interns have no badges until noon; escort them through turnstiles in groups of four. Do not prop the east stairwell door. Lanyards are in the supply cupboard, third shelf. If the group exceeds twelve, split between two escorts. For the interim period, use the temporary pass below.

door code, yagap-bahof: bdg-O-05

[ ] Barcode scanner hookup (Beepwright SDK): plugin authors, double-check your scan callbacks against the new debounce behavior — rapid duplicate scans are now collapsed within 300ms, so don't rely on getting every raw event. Test with both laser and camera scanner profiles before you publish. If your plugin passes the conformance suite, pin your compatibility declaration to the certified build identified by the token below.

trace token, kahog-tajeg: htk6_97d963

**14:22 UTC — Stale-branch cleanup bot misfires.** The Tidyhedge bot on the Lanternfall repo deleted three branches that were still referenced by open review requests. If you're new to this team: the bot's age threshold was set to 14 days, but the reference check silently failed against the mirror. Recovery began at 14:40 once Priya Valden restored from reflog. The offending bot run is traceable by the token below.

session token of tajef-bageg = htk21_5d90d574934f3ccae6437

# Handover: Puzzlewright crossword generator

Hey — quick brain dump before I'm out. The generator service is stable; grid fill runs on the worker pool and the clue picker hits the themed wordlist cache. Known quirk: 21x21 grids sometimes time out on Mondays when the cache is cold, just rerun the job. The nightly batch kicks off at 02:00 and posts results to the editor queue. Everything it needs at runtime is captured in the config below.

deployment values, fafog-fawip:
[jorox]
team = fendor
access_code = ac_bb00ea
host = jorox.qorveltech.internal
port = 9200
owner = istdor.aldeth
peer = julvan.orvexlabs.internal